How is the Amuse exhaust? Did you do a dyno comparison with stock? |
Thanks guys.
Hey pechs good to see your still on the boards. Mike, the Amuse is really nice, great sound and very light. It is about 20 kilos lighter than the stock peice, thats where the main difference is. I didnt bother with before and after dyno. The Amuse dual is known to be the best dual on the market, with around 6 whp gain. I noticed the car has abit more urge in the 4000rpm range, and the rpm range feels smoother. Also the sound is awesome pre vtec, so you dont need to rev it out to redline to hear the thing. The amuse and the stock exhaust are basically in design the same before the mufflers. The mufflers are large and straight through, that is where it frees it up I guess. Im really happy with the Amuse though, exactly what I wanted, next best would be the fujitsubo, but that isnt as light and I dont like the canisters that are shiney. |

I just realised that the glass window is smaller, is it because the folding motor mechanism different with 02+ model?
|
Glass window is smaller, due to the roof having to fold down into the parcel tray. The plastic is larger as it can fold in half. I liek it smaller, best looking softtop on the market I reckon.

Thanks vyets, the leather is not smooth like the oem, and it grips heaps.
I used to take a corner on the way home and have to hold the handbrake to stay in the car lol. Now I can just chuck the car and the seat holds. Makes the car feel more stable, cos you can feel what its doing more under you. I think the centre being mesh helps too, it is really comfy, and you wont sweat as much as you do with leather. The rails cost me $250 and the seat to source new are about $1350 landed. Its a nice compromise seat, comfy and holding at the same time, oh and full access to compartment and no rubbing on the door trim like some. |
